FeedAudit validates podcast RSS feeds against the Castline publishing spec. All endpoints sit behind the internal Gatemark auth proxy. Requests require a service key in the auth header; missing or malformed keys return 401 with no diagnostic detail. Keys are scoped read-only for validation endpoints and cannot trigger feed republication. Rate limits apply per key, not per IP. Rotation is enforced every 90 days; expired keys fail closed. Audit logs record key fingerprint, never the full value. The current review-scoped Gatemark key follows.

service key, fawip-bajef: kto11_Qt5wZK9vdNC

/*
 * Client setup for the Murretta Hall audio-guide app.
 * This client fetches narration manifests from the Soundpath
 * internal service over TLS 1.3 only; certificate pinning is
 * enforced in the transport layer above. Scope of this key is
 * read-only manifest access — it cannot mutate exhibit data.
 * The key immediately below authenticates against Soundpath staging.
 */

app token of yajeg-kawef = kto11_7En3XSX8xQw

## Artifact Signing — SDK Parity Releases

Quick heads-up for new folks: the Lumabird Kotlin and Swift SDKs ship together, always. If one gets a feature, the other waits until parity lands — no solo releases, ever. Once the parity checklist is green, CI builds both archives and runs the shared contract tests. Both artifacts get signed in the same pipeline stage so versions can't drift. The signing stage uses the key below.

release key, hadug-kawef: bky13_mPGeFZeR1GZ1G